Kosovo - Solid Fossil Fuels Final Consumption by Households
Since 2014, Kosovo Solid Fossil Fuels Final Consumption by Households fell by 29% year on year. With 29.29 Gigawatthours in 2019, the country was ranked number 23 among other countries in Solid Fossil Fuels Final Consumption by Households. Kosovo is overtaken by Croatia, which was ranked number 22 with 32.3 Gigawatthours and is followed by Montenegro with 24.94 Gigawatthours. Poland topped the ranking with 57,903.29 Gigawatthours in 2019, that is a fall of 19.1% compared to 2018. Turkey, Czech Republic and United Kingdom resp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Greece witnessed the best average annual growth at +14.4% per year, while Slovenia was the worst growing country at -32.1% per year.
